Hi, I got this .iso folder of Windows Vista Ultimate and he needs me to burn it on to a dvd. I tried once before but it didnt work.

This is what i did:
Made a new burn folder.
Opened the .iso
Dragged everything into the burn folder.
Burned.
Didn't work.


Does anyone have an idea on how to burn this .iso folder on to a Clean DVD?

Cheers. :D
 
Just burning the contents won't actually copy it properly, the ISO format involves more than just files. Disk Utility may be able to burn it.

If not, download the free program Burn to do it for you.
 
Use Disk Utility to burn it. You don't need to make burn folders or anything.

Disk Utility > Burn > Select ISO etc
